Position Summary


The Structural Superintendent is responsible for planning, coordinating, and managing all field operations related to structural construction on heavy civil infrastructure projects. This includes overseeing structural bridge construction, retaining walls, foundations, cast-in-place concrete, structural steel erection, precast concrete installation, and other complex structural elements.

The Structural Superintendent ensures work is completed safely, on schedule, within budget, and in accordance with project specifications while maintaining the highest standards of quality, production, and safety. This individual provides leadership to field crews, foremen, subcontractors, and vendors while working closely with Project Managers, Project Engineers, owners, and inspectors to successfully deliver complex structural construction projects.


Responsibilities


  • Plan, organize, and direct all structural construction activities in coordination with the Project Manager. 
  • Lead field operations for structural concrete, structural steel, bridge components, retaining walls, foundations, drilled shafts, pile foundations, and other heavy civil structural work.
  • Supervise field personnel, foremen, subcontractors, and equipment to ensure safe and efficient project execution.
  • Develop and maintain project schedules, including daily work plans and three-week look-ahead schedules.
  • Monitor labor productivity, equipment utilization, production quantities, and overall project performance.
  • Review and approve daily reports, labor time sheets, equipment reports, and installed quantities.
  • Coordinate material deliveries, subcontractor activities, inspections, testing, and quality control.
  • Identify schedule impacts, field conflicts, changed conditions, and additional work opportunities, communicating them promptly to the Project Manager and Project Engineer.
  • Review monthly cost reports and assist in managing project budgets by controlling labor, equipment, and material costs.
  • Ensure all work is performed in accordance with contract documents, project specifications, company standards, and applicable regulations.
  • Enforce all company safety policies and OSHA requirements while promoting a proactive safety culture.
  • Conduct daily safety huddles, stretching exercises, Job Hazard Analyses (JHAs), and weekly toolbox talks.
  • Develop material handling and installation plans with field leadership.
  • Maintain strong working relationships with owners, engineers, subcontractors, inspectors, and project stakeholders.
  • Mentor and develop Foremen and field personnel through coaching, training, and performance management.
  • Prepare weekly accountability reports and regularly communicate project status to the General Superintendent and Project Management team.


Qualifications


  • B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ering, Construction Management, or a related field preferred, but not required.
  • Minimum of 8 years of progressive experience managing structural construction on heavy civil infrastructure projects.
  • Demonstrated experience supervising projects involving:
  • Structural bridge construction
  • Cast-in-place concrete
  • Structural steel erection
  • Precast concrete installation
  • Foundations, drilled shafts, piles, footings, and abutments
  • Retaining walls and other structural concrete systems
  • Strong knowledge of heavy civil construction methods, sequencing, scheduling, quality control, and production management.
  • Experience managing multiple crews, subcontractors, and self-performed work.
  • OSHA 10 certification required; OSHA 30 preferred.
  • Ability to read and interpret construction drawings, specifications, schedules, and contract documents.
  • Experience working on DOT, municipal, or other public infrastructure projects preferred.
